Understanding Android App Testing and Its Importance


Android app testing involves assessing an application to confirm it meets defined requirements and performs consistently under different conditions. Unlike many platforms, Android runs on a broad range of devices with varying screen sizes, hardware specifications, and software versions. This diversity makes testing more complex and essential.

Thorough testing helps uncover defects, performance concerns, and compatibility challenges prior to deployment. It guarantees that features function correctly, navigation remains smooth, and the app stays stable even during heavy usage. Without effective testing, applications risk crashing, lagging, or delivering inconsistent experiences, which can negatively impact user perception.

Types of Android App Testing


A complete testing approach includes various testing types to address every aspect of an application. Functional testing confirms that features operate in line with requirements. It checks that all interface elements and workflows behave correctly.

Performance testing assesses application behaviour under different loads, measuring speed, responsiveness, and reliability. This is particularly important for apps with high user traffic or real-time functionality.

Usability testing evaluates the user experience, ensuring the interface is clear and easy to use. A good app design ensures users can accomplish tasks effortlessly.

Compatibility testing confirms that the app functions across multiple devices, screen sizes, and OS versions. Security testing identifies vulnerabilities and protects user data from potential threats.

Together, these testing methods help create a strong and dependable Android application.

Common Challenges in Android App Testing


Android app testing presents unique challenges because of platform fragmentation. Teams must ensure compatibility across a wide range of devices with diverse specifications and configurations.

Frequent updates to the Android operating system also require continuous testing to maintain compatibility. Network variations can also affect performance, requiring testing across different connectivity scenarios.

Ensuring a consistent user experience is another major challenge. Variations in screen resolution and device performance can affect how an app looks and behaves. Overcoming these issues requires a strategic testing approach and the right tools.

Best Practices for Effective Android App Testing


To ensure quality results, adopting proven testing methods is essential. Early-stage testing helps uncover issues before they escalate into costly problems. Continuous testing ensures that updates and features do not introduce defects.

Automation is crucial for improving efficiency in testing. Automation enables quick validation of repetitive tasks and faster feedback, freeing teams to address complex scenarios.

Real device testing is crucial for accurate android app testing results. Although emulators are helpful, real device testing offers a realistic view of performance in actual conditions.

Proper documentation and structured test cases help maintain consistency and track progress efficiently. Regular updates and regression testing further ensure that existing features remain stable after changes.

The Role of Automation in Android App Testing


Automation has revolutionised the testing process. It speeds up test execution, reduces manual workload, and increases precision. Automated tools simulate interactions, confirm functionality, and detect problems effectively.

In large-scale projects, automation proves valuable by supporting parallel testing across multiple devices and setups. This shortens development timelines and supports faster releases while maintaining quality.

However, automation should be balanced with manual testing. While automated tests handle repetitive tasks, manual testing is essential for evaluating user experience and identifying issues that require human judgement.

The Evolving Future of Android App Testing


As technology progresses, Android app testing is becoming increasingly sophisticated. AI and machine learning are now integrated into testing to enhance accuracy and efficiency. These technologies help predict issues, optimise test cases, and improve testing strategies.

Cloud-based testing platforms are also gaining popularity, allowing teams to test applications on a wide range of devices without maintaining physical hardware. This strategy increases scalability while reducing expenses.
